    Did you and your computer survive Daylight Savings Time?

    All but two of mine (and those I manage) did, and with no special actions on my part.

    My secret?  Microsoft Update.  I install the patches on a regular basis, either manually (on my servers) or via Windows OneCare.  If you have an XP or Windows Server 2003 box, your OS is golden.

    The two exceptions were Windows 2000 boxes which I updated manually using How to configure daylight saving time for the United States in 2007.  TZEdit is the easiest if you're updating only one or two systems.

    I did have to pay a visit to the Windows Mobile Updates for Daylight Savings Time page to update my Treo 700W; that was trivial.  I also checked the Time Zone Data Update Tool for Microsoft Office Outlook just to be sure.
